基于区块链的身份验证机制.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

PAGE48/NUMPAGES56

基于区块链的身份验证机制

TOC\o1-3\h\z\u

第一部分区块链技术概述 2

第二部分传统身份验证分析 9

第三部分区块链身份特性 14

第四部分基于区块链设计 21

第五部分去中心化实现方式 30

第六部分安全性能评估 38

第七部分应用场景探讨 42

第八部分发展趋势分析 48

第一部分区块链技术概述

关键词

关键要点

区块链的基本原理

1.区块链是一种分布式、去中心化的数据库技术,通过密码学方法将数据块链接成链式结构,确保数据不可篡改和可追溯。

2.其核心机制包括分布式账本、共识算法(如PoW、PoS)和智能合约,实现数据的多方验证和自动执行。

3.数据在区块链上以加密形式存储,每个节点拥有完整账本副本,增强系统的抗攻击性和透明度。

区块链的架构特征

1.区块链由底层硬件层、协议层和应用层构成,其中底层硬件层包括节点设备,协议层定义数据交互规则。

2.共识机制是区块链架构的核心,如工作量证明(PoW)通过算力竞争验证交易,权益证明(PoS)则基于代币数量分配验证权。

3.智能合约作为区块链的扩展功能,可自动执行预设条件,推动去中介化应用落地。

区块链的共识算法

1.工作量证明(PoW)通过哈希算力竞赛确保交易顺序,以比特币为例,每10分钟生成新区块,算力投入决定节点地位。

2.权益证明(PoS)将验证权与代币质押挂钩,以太坊2.0采用混合共识模型(Casper-FFG),降低能耗并提升效率。

3.委托权益证明(DPoS)进一步优化,由投票产生的少数代表(见证人)负责区块生成,实现高速交易处理。

区块链的安全机制

1.加密算法(如SHA-256、ECC)保障数据传输和存储安全,哈希链式结构使篡改行为可被全网识别。

2.分叉机制(软分叉、硬分叉)用于协议升级,如比特币的隔离验证(SegWit)提升交易吞吐量。

3.共识算法的防攻击设计,如PoW的51%攻击门槛较高,而PoS的惩罚机制(质押损失)增强网络韧性。

区块链的分布式特性

1.分布式账本技术(DLT)实现数据冗余存储,单个节点故障不影响系统运行,如HyperledgerFabric采用联盟链架构。

2.节点类型分为全节点、轻节点和验证节点,按角色分担记账、验证和查询任务,优化资源分配。

3.跨链技术(如Polkadot、Cosmos)打破链间壁垒,实现资产和信息的互操作性,推动多链协同发展。

区块链的应用趋势

1.数字身份(DID)领域,区块链提供去中心化身份管理方案,如uPort、Civic平台通过自证数据降低隐私泄露风险。

2.供应链溯源场景,区块链记录商品全生命周期数据,蚂蚁区块链的溯源系统覆盖农产品、奢侈品等高价值领域。

3.中央银行数字货币(CBDC)探索,如数字人民币(e-CNY)依托联盟链技术,实现可控匿名与监管合规平衡。

#区块链技术概述

区块链技术是一种分布式、去中心化的数据库技术,通过密码学方法确保数据的安全性和不可篡改性。其核心特征在于去中心化、不可篡改、透明可追溯和共识机制,这些特征使得区块链技术在身份验证、数据管理、智能合约等领域具有广泛的应用前景。本文将详细阐述区块链技术的关键组成部分及其工作原理,为后续探讨基于区块链的身份验证机制奠定基础。

一、区块链的基本概念

区块链是一种分布式账本技术,通过将数据以区块的形式进行存储,并通过密码学方法将每个区块链接起来,形成一个不可篡改的链式结构。每个区块包含了一定数量的交易记录,并通过哈希函数与上一个区块进行关联,确保数据的完整性和安全性。区块链的基本概念包括以下几个核心要素:

1.分布式账本:区块链数据存储在多个节点上,每个节点都拥有一份完整的账本副本,任何节点的数据变更都需要经过网络中其他节点的验证,从而实现数据的去中心化管理。

2.哈希函数:哈希函数是一种将任意长度的数据映射为固定长度输出的算法,具有单向性和抗碰撞性。区块链中,每个区块的哈希值是其内容的唯一标识,任何对区块内容的微小改动都会导致哈希值的变化,从而被网络中的其他节点识别。

3.共识机制:共识机制是区块链网络中用于验证交易并达成一致意见的规则。常见的共识机制包括工作量证明(ProofofWork,PoW)、权益证明(ProofofStake,PoS)和委托权益证明(DelegatedProofofStake,DPoS)等。共识机制确保了区块链网络中的数据一

文档评论(0)

布丁文库 + 关注
官方认证
文档贡献者

该用户很懒,什么也没介绍

认证主体 重庆微铭汇信息技术有限公司
IP属地浙江
统一社会信用代码/组织机构代码
91500108305191485W

1亿VIP精品文档

相关文档